Pay Rates:

Trainee Driver - Pay Rate: £12.60 - £14.75 per hour

£12.60 per hour - During training and mentoring (around 8 weeks).

£13.20 per hour - 6 months’ probation period.

£14.75 per hour - after successful probation completion.

Fully Qualified PCV Drivers

£13.20 per hour for the first 6 months of probation (*Must have 1-year of PCV experience in the last 5 years).

£14.75 after passing your probation (*Must have 1-year PCV experience to move to a higher rate).

Pay rates reviewed via frequent pay negotiations.

What’s in It for You?

  • Trainee Drivers: Full paid training, including obtaining your PCV licence through our Arriva Training School.
  • Ongoing CPC training for all drivers and professional development opportunities.
  • Career progression into management, support training, or becoming an expert driver.
  • Flexible and rotating shifts planned 6-8 weeks in advance.
  • Free bus travel for you and your family (or a nominee).
  • Access to the Arriva Village for store discounts and offers.
  • Free staff bus and shuttle services to and from work.
  • Monthly rewards through the Mydrive app for top-performing drivers.

Shift Patterns:

  • 5 out of 7 rotating shift patterns, planned up to 6-8 weeks in advance so you can plan around shifts.
  • Mornings starting from 04:00, Afternoons start from 12:00 and Evenings from 18:00 on a rotational basis.
  • We cannot offer fixed early, afternoon or evenings separately.
  • Overtime available on request.

Requirements:

  • Be over 18 years old with at least 6 months of driving experience.
  • Hold a valid UK driving licence with no more than 6 penalty points.
  • Pass a drug and alcohol test.
  • Great customer service and communication skills.
  • Hold a full PCV licence (if qualified PCV driver)
  • No more than 6 penalty points.
  • Pass a drug and alcohol test.
  • Demonstrate excellent customer service and communication skills.
